Description du poste

Mohammed VI Polytechnic University is an institution oriented towards applied research and innovation with a focus on Africa.

MAScIR-UM6P is seeking a highly motivated and experienced postdoctoral researcher to join our team in the study of seaweed biology and its valorization. The position focuses on developing innovative and sustainable strategies for converting seaweeds biomass into valuable bio-based products and understanding the biological properties of seaweeds, with an emphasis on their potential applications in biotechnology, agriculture, and other bioproducts applications. This research will explore the chemical and biological aspects of seaweeds, along with their valorization for new products such as biostimulants to enhance soil health and carbon sequestration.

Job Responsibilities

  • Conduct cutting-edge research on the conversion processes of various types of biomass (e.g., seaweeds) into valuable bio-based products.
  • Investigate and optimize technologies for biomass pretreatment, enzymatic hydrolysis, fermentation, and other biochemical or thermochemical processes.
  • Investigate the potential of seaweed-derived compounds for use in agriculture, including their role as biostimulants, organic fertilizers, or crop protection agents.
  • Develop and optimize methods to extract, isolate, and characterize valuable bioactive compounds (e.g., polysaccharides, proteins, polyphenols) from seaweeds.
  • Assess the potential applications of seaweed-based products in agriculture.
  • Design and conduct experiments to assess the functional properties of seaweed extracts and their impact on soil health, plant growth, and environmental sustainability.
  • Explore innovative methods for processing of seaweeds to ensure sustainable valorization and minimize environmental impact.
  • Analyze experimental data using appropriate statistical methods, providing insights into the biological properties of seaweeds and their industrial applications.
  • Prepare research findings for publication in high-impact scientific journals and present results at international conferences and symposia.
  • Present research findings at conferences and collaborate with industry partners or stakeholders on practical applications of research.
  • Collaborate with an interdisciplinary team, including experts in marine biology, environmental science, agricultural technology, and industrial biotechnology.
  • Mentor graduate students, interns, or research assistants involved in related projects.

Qualifications:

  • Ph.D. in Chemical Engineering, Biotechnology, Environmental Science, or a related field.
  • Strong background in biomass conversion technologies (e.g., thermochemical, biochemical, or enzymatic processes).
  • Experience with seaweed valorization, biochemical analysis, and extraction techniques.
  • Familiarity with the industrial valorization of marine resources, including their potential applications in agriculture.
  • Proficiency in experimental design, data analysis, and statistical software.
  • Excellent written and oral communication skills, with a proven track record of scientific publications.
  • Ability to work independently as well as collaboratively in a multidisciplinary research environment.

About UM6P:

Mohammed VI Polytechnic University is an institution dedicated to research and innovation in Africa and aims to position itself among world-renowned universities in its fields. The University is engaged in economic and human development and puts research and innovation at the forefront of African development. A mechanism that enables it to consolidate Morocco's frontline position in these fields, in a unique partnership-based approach and boosting skills training relevant for the future of Africa.
Located in the municipality of Benguerir, in the very heart of the Green City, Mohammed VI Polytechnic University aspires to leave its mark nationally, continentally, and globally.
